Fiber optic splice closures are designed to withstand various environmental conditions while ensuring the integrity of the fiber connections. Below is a comparison table highlighting the key technical features of these closures:

Feature Description
Material Typically made from high-tensile plastics like PC, PP, or PP+GF.
Waterproof Rating Designed to be waterproof, preventing moisture damage to the fibers.
Tensile Strength High tensile resistance to protect against external pressure and compaction.
Sealing Mechanism Effective sealing to keep out dust and contaminants.
Port Capacity Varies by model, accommodating multiple fiber connections.
Installation Type Can be installed aerially, underground, or in ducts.
Temperature Resistance Capable of withstanding extreme temperatures without degrading.
Accessibility Some models offer easy access for maintenance and re-entry.

There are various types of fiber optic splice closures, each designed for specific applications and environments. The following table outlines the primary types and their characteristics:

Type Description
Horizontal Closure Flat or cylindrical design, suitable for aerial or underground applications.
Vertical Closure Dome-shaped, ideal for buried or pole-mounted installations.
In-line Closure Used for connecting two lengths of fiber cable in a straight line.
Branch Closure Allows for branching off to additional fiber lines.
Dome Closure Provides robust protection and is often used in harsh environments.

1. What is a fiber optic splice closure?
A fiber optic splice closure is a protective enclosure that houses and organizes spliced fiber optic cables, ensuring their integrity and reliability.

2. How do I choose the right splice closure for my project?
Consider factors such as cable compatibility, port capacity, installation type, and environmental conditions when selecting a splice closure.

3. Are fiber optic splice closures waterproof?
Yes, most fiber optic splice closures are designed to be waterproof, protecting the internal fibers from moisture damage.

4. Can I use a vertical splice closure for aerial applications?
Yes, vertical splice closures can be used in aerial applications, provided they are designed to withstand environmental hazards.

5. What materials are used in the construction of splice closures?
Fiber optic splice closures are typically made from high-tensile plastics like PC, PP, or PP+GF, ensuring durability and protection against the elements.
